Crystals of Yb3Sc2Ga3O12:Cr3+:Ho3+ as a promising material for cascade lasing of Ho3+ ions

A. L. Denisov, A. I. Zagumennyi, G. B. Lutts, V. V. Osiko, S. G. Semenkov, A. F. Umyskov


Abstract: An investigation was made of the possibility of lasing of Ho3+ ions in a Yb3Sc2Ga3O12:Cr3+:Ho3+ crystal in accordance with a cascade scheme 5I65I75I8 using flashlamp pumping at room temperature. The lifetime of the 2F5/2 level of the Yb3+ ion and of the 5I6 and 5I7 levels of the Ho3+ ion were determined. The efficiency of the Cr3+→Yb3+→Ho3+ energy transfer chain was 60%.
